On Monday evenings, the welcoming and friendly astronomers of King’s Lynn & District Astronomy Society meet at Tottenhill Village Hall.

On the second and fourth Monday’s of each month, meetings include a presentation by a guest speaker then observing using telescopes afterwards, weather permitting.

On all other Mondays, and only if weather conditions are favourable, the meeting is devoted to observations. These evenings are perfect for beginners and are a great way to learn how to view the night sky. Non-members are very welcome to join in; no equipment is necessary; however, you are welcome to take your own telescope if you have one.
